TV Star Emma Cornell

BIOGRAPHY
Emma Cornell is a personal trainer from New South Wales. Emma is the eldest of seven children, and describes herself as the black sheep of her family. Emma also describes herself as daring, stubborn and vivacious. Emma is a former Adelaide-based model and was winner of the South Australian section of the Ralph Swimsuit Model of the Year competition in 2005. Emma underwent breast enlargement surgery more than six-months before entering the Big Brother House to enhance her modelling career. She was the subject of a nude pictorial for Zoo Weekly, photographed before she entered the Big Brother House, in the 14 May Edition. Emma has an English-born partner, Tim Stanton, also a personal trainer, and they had lived together in Sydney prior to Emma entering the Big Brother House.

Emma's father died on 16 May 2007 whilst Emma was still in the Big Brother House and she was not advised of his death. Emma and her father had been estranged for six years although they had recently been communicating through text messages. Her father's dying wish was that Emma not be informed of his death until after she had left the Big Brother house. He had hoped that his death would not receive publicity, however news of his passing was leaked to the news media. Emma's brother Matt reported that their father had endured a long illness and the family had had some time to prepare themselves. In an open letter to the Australian public, which was posted on the official Big Brother website, Matt Cornell explained that he and Emma had "discussed the possibility of dad’s death thoroughly. I can confirm with absolute confidence that Emma has prepared herself and her views have been considered in the family’s decision-making process." This news has been reported internationally. Psychologist Chris Hall, from the Australian Centre for Grief and Bereavement, criticised the decision to not inform Emma. He said she should be told of her father's death to allow her make her own choice about how to deal with it. With ratings down on previous seasons, the program's producers are worried that this situation could have a negative impact on the show's viewing figures. The producers of the series have confirmed that, on her eviction from the house, they would advise Emma of her father's death in private and away from television cameras.

Family First Queensland Senate candidate Jeff Buchanan described the situation as an "unbelievable disgrace". He said that "This has to be the lowest of the low. How will Emma be able to look back and feel as though she had a proper choice to do the right thing?" Academic and media commentator Catharine Lumby, who consulted with the producers on behavioural issues, said this only brought to public attention another ethical dilemma. "This is the great ethical value of Big Brother because it highlights dilemmas that are already there. It doesn't create them," she said. Communications Minister Helen Coonan would not comment, saying it was "a family matter". On May 28 Big Brother producer Kris Noble wrote to the press saying that "we were not aware that Emma's father had died until it was disclosed to the press by persons unknown. This took place after the funeral service. This in turn led to media speculation that the producers of Big Brother chose not to tell Emma about her father's death and would somehow use the tragedy as a grab for ratings, causing further distress for the family who wanted to keep their sad news private."

On the evening of 28 May during the staging of the live Nominations show two audience members held up a sign reading "Emma, Your Dad Is Dead", presumably hoping a housemate would see it during a live cross between host Gretel Killeen and the housemates during the program. However the Nomination show features no such live crosses; these are in fact a feature of Eviction shows. They were discovered and ejected from the audience. Emma became the eighth housemate to be evicted on Day 50 by public voting with 76% of the merged vote, along with Rebecca in a double eviction. Emma had been informed of her father's death during a meeting with her brother Matt and a psychologist, 24 hours prior to her eviction. The issue of her father's death was only briefly mentioned when Emma appeared on the stage during the eviction show. Emma stated that "I want to leave it alone tonight as was my father's wish." After two weeks of doing public appearances for Big Brother she cancelled all future appearances.
